Heavy lifting is the only thing that’s stuck for the way my brain works. I used a program called 5x5:

  • only 5 different lifts to learn, each full body so there’s no fiddly minmaxing
  • more or less timeboxed. 5 sets of 5 reps 3 times with about a minute between each rep and set. To improve, you add more weight, not spend more time
  • consistent, once you get the routine down, and you know roughly how long it’ll take, you can just let your body take over, coast on muscle memory and motor neurons, zone back in in an hour when you’re done
  • numeric satisfaction as your weights increase in fixed increments.
  • immediate gratification because functional strength is neat and comes on surprisingly fast

Downside: So hungry, all the time.
